Here is my unofficial list of 16.5 Ways To Earn $$ in the Real Estate World This Year:
1) List properties
2) Represent buyers
3) Auction properties
4) Work as a referral agent. Prospect for leads and refer away!
5) Become an expert witness
6) Complete Broker’s Price Opinions (BPO’s)
7) Work as a Real Estate consultant
8) Work as a property manager
9) Specialize in new construction – work for a builder
10) Obtain a Broker’s license (after 3 yrs. of full time Real Estate Sales) and manage an office
11) Better yet…become a Broker in order to own your own office!
12) Become a trainer/coach/speaker/instructor/coach
13) Consider working as a short-sale negotiator for an attorney’s office or a bank
14) Look for staff positions for the corporate offices of one of the big brands. For instance, Realogy (parent company of Coldwell Banker, ERA, C21 and Sothebys) is in Parsippany, NJ
15) Specialize as a commercial agent
16) Manage commercial rentals
and 16.5) Look for a parallel business to fit hand-in-hand with your Real Estate career. One suggestion that appears to work quite nicely for agents is to branch out into Real Estate investments and become either a landlord or a ‘flipper’.
